Bullseye starts moving for casting above 920 c (1700 f), at 980 c (1800 f) it flows nicely.Colin wrote:Helen wants me to cast a couple pieces ....in non Pb glass.. so our glass choice is Bullseye ..crushed up sheets and scrap... my question is what is the flow temperature. for BE ( I haven't used BE for some time and have also lost all my records from previous firings for this glass)..Colin
